✎ REQUESTING A PHOTO? » Before submitting your grave/headstone photo request, please contact the cemetery in question and obtain as much of the following info as possible: the person's maiden (and other) names as listed on the grave marker or death certificate; the cemetery name, address (and/or GPS coordinates); the death date (and birth date); and most importantly -- the plot#, section/row#, lot#, or grave#. The more info you can provide, the greater chance I'll have at taking care of your request. Thank you~

I will need the following info from you: the person's name on the death certificate, birth date, death date, cemetery name and location (or if not buried then note if cremated, lost at sea etc), and any other verifiable info or photos you'd like to have included (obituary etc). You're welcome to include additional genealogical/family tree info, such as any maiden/married names they've held, what their spouse's names are, their children's names, maternal and paternal parent's names, etc. (For safety/privacy reasons, I highly recommend that you do not list living relatives' full names - just initials will do, or else limit your list to deceased relatives only.)
